Coweta County’s top planning and engineering departments will see new leadership following a series of internal promotions involving three of the county’s longest-serving employees.
Jon Amason, who has led Community Development for the past seven years, will return to his engineering background as the new Division Director of Engineering in Public Works.
Amason joined the county in 2008 as an engineering assistant and advanced through the ranks to senior engineer before being appointed Community Development director. During his tenure, he oversaw a major departmental reorganization that brought Development Review, Planning and Zoning, Comprehensive Planning, Code Enforcement, and Business and Alcohol Licensing under one umbrella.
